Artemidorus Aristophanius

Artemidorus (Ancient Greek: Ἀρτεμίδωρος) was a grammarian of ancient Greece who lived around the late 3rd and early 2nd centuries BCE. He was often called Aristophanius or Pseudo-Aristophanius owing to his having been a disciple of Aristophanes of Byzantium, the celebrated Librarian of Alexandria, as well as of Aristophanes's successor, Aristarchus of Samothrace.

His works are sometimes confused with those of another grammarian named Artemidorus, Artemidorus of Tarsus, who sometimes wrote about the playwright Aristophanes.
